SAFe Team Kanban is an Agile method used by teams within an Agile Release Train (ART) to continuously deliver value. SAFe Kanban teams apply a flow-based process to their daily work and operate within the Agile Release Train (ART) iteration cadence. Most Agile Teams use SAFe Scrum as their primary method to deliver value.
